Lt Hans Koeppen And The 1908 Great Race

Hans Friedrich Wilhelm Hugo Koeppen was born in Minden close to Hanover July 31, 1876. His father was an Oberst (Colonel) in the Old Prussian Army and young Hans followed in his footsteps by joining the household business enterprise. He entered the Imperial German Army of the Kaiser Wilhelm II as a Lieutenant in the 15th Infantry Regiment (2nd Westf&aumllisches) March 1894. By 1903 the brilliant and upcoming officer was promoted to Oberleutnant and sent to the elite War Academy. Upon graduation he was attached to the Grand General Staff in 1907. When the stories of an American, French and Italian teams competing in a race from New York west to Paris across Germany reached Koeppen, a patriot, he was eager to see a German effort place forth. Choosing out that the Kaiser himself desired a German entry into the 22,000- mile (35,000-kilometer) race, the young Lieutenant immediately presented himself in hopes of a promotion.

The Protos Car in the Good 1908 Race

Initial factor the German team needed was a vehicle and they turned to the compact Berlin-based German enterprise of Protos just after Benz and Daimler politely bowed out. Designing a custom constructed vehicle in only 16 days, the Protos racing automobile was an impressive 16 feet lengthy, 6.5 feet wide, and when loaded with 3 males, an substantial spare components kit, food and 176 gallons of gas weighed some three tons. She was powered by a 40hp engine that could propel the beast at up to 70mph. There was no cab and the trip across the open skies of United States and Siberia would be beneath cover of absolutely nothing far more than canvas. The Protos was roughly the very same size as a modern Chevrolet Suburban built with steam-era technology.

The Make-up of the German Race Team

To aid subsidize the expenditures of the race Hans Koeppen agreed to file stories for the newspaper Zeitung am Mittag. Since Han Koeppen had never ever truly driven a auto before, 35-year old club-driver Hans Knappe was selected to be the main wheelman of the Protos. Knappe had also had been an officer in the Prussian Army, in the Field Engineers and had competed in a number of auto races currently. The third and last member of the team was the mechanic and chauffer Ernest Maas. It was this team that started off from New York toward Seattle. The 22,000 mile race was on and to this day remains the longest car race in the world.
